**The team | Mō tō māou rōpū**

The University’s award-winning Alumni Relations and Development (ARD) office forms the centralised point of contact for philanthropic partners and for alumni and friends. Our team includes Development and Alumni Relations personnel and staff to support them and external Foundations by providing a range of activities and communications to build lasting mutually beneficial relationships.

These relationships contribute expertise, advocacy and philanthropic funds that help the University of Auckland to play its part in the developing knowledge and people for the good of Auckland, New Zealand and the global community.

Due to a recent internal promotion, the University’s Alumni Relations and Development Office is seeking to appoint a new **Development Manager** to work with our **Faculty of Business & Economics.**

**The opportunity | Te Whiwhinga mahi**

The main purpose of the position is to raise philanthropic funds for the Faculty of Business & Economics through the effective development and implementation of a coordinated, integrated and enduring Faculty Development Plan. The faculty is multi-faceted, with strengths across research, preservice, postgraduate and doctoral study, professional learning and development. The faculty’s focus is to champion an inclusive education and social work system that truly delivers - a vision that has attracted impressive and inspiring philanthropic support. Some key responsibilities include:

- ** Strategy, Planning & Decision Making** - Contribute to the development of the strategic and annual operational plans for the Development function in line with the Dean’s and Alumni Relations and Development Office directive.
- ** Stakeholder Relationships** - Demonstrate a high level of interpersonal skills through relationship management, advocacy and negotiation. Personally manage a portfolio of gift prospects through the cycle of development. Also, work closely in partnership with the Faculty, Dean and Development Office to deliver a coordinated approach.
- ** Operational Activities** - Ensure major donors are recipients of highly effective programme of acknowledgment, recognition, reporting and engagement. Responsible for the all prospect management for the faculty and ensuring each prospect has a well maintained plan.
- ** Financial Management - **Inform the preparation of budgets in conjunction with faculty finance and manage across relevant department cost centres in accordance with University policy, standards and guidelines. Closely monitor that donor scholarships are awarded and moneys spent in the year specified
- ** Continuous Improvement and Project Management - **Attend regular meetings of all Development Managers and work closely with the Alumni Relations and Development team. Undertake projects as directed by the Director of Alumni Relations and Development, Dean, associate deans and/or identify projects that will advance the development of department activities within the faculty.
